The rapid growth of tobacco farming in Jamestown led to several significant problems, including environmental degradation due to over-farming and soil depletion. Additionally, the demand for labor increased dramatically, which contributed to the expansion of the slave trade and the use of indentured servants. This reliance on tobacco also made the economy highly dependent on a single crop, making it vulnerable to market fluctuations and crop failures.

A monoculture farm is a farming system where only one type of crop is grown across a large area. This type of farming can lead to problems such as soil depletion, increased susceptibility to pests and diseases, and negative impacts on biodiversity.
